We have these at work (Army). I originally found out about them by using equipment housed in one. They are better than pelicans in every way. I did my own little torture test on one (as if supporting a hmvee wasn't enough). I took out the equipment and put in computer foam and an egg in a plastic bag. After about 10 minutes of throwing the case overhand into walls, jumping on it and playing hockey with it... the egg was still intact, the only damage was the scratching and marring on the surface of the case. I'm totally 100% sold on them. I will be getting their largest case with wheels, it will be able to house 5 of my guns with barrels and air systems just right. The case I used in the test was their smallest one.
